SMOKED GOUDA PIMIENTO CHEESE



Smoked Gouda Pimiento Cheese image

Provided by Martina McBride

Categories     condiment

Time 20m

Yield 4 cups

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up mayonnaise
1 (7-ounce) jar diced pimiento, drained and rinsed
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 (8-ounce) block extra-sharp Cheddar cheese, shredded (about 2 cups)
1 (8-ounce) block smoked Gouda cheese, shredded (about 2 cups)

Steps:

  • Stir together the mayonnaise, pimientos, Worcestershire, garlic powder, and cayenne in a large bowl; add the cheeses, stirring until blended. Store in the refrigerator up to 1 week.

SMOKED PIMIENTO CHEESE CROSTINI



Smoked Pimiento Cheese Crostini image

Pimiento cheese has long been a favorite in our family, so these bite-sized appetizers are a treat! I add Worcestershire sauce and hot sauce to give them a little kick. Caramelized onions create another layer of flavor. You can make the cheese and onions three to five days in advance; they store well. If you need to save time, you can use premade jalapeno pimiento cheese. -Caitlyn Bunch, Trenton, Georgia

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ers

Time 1h

Yield 4 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 21

48 slices French bread baguette (1/4 inch thick)
CARAMELIZED ONIONS:
2 tablespoons canola oil
2 large onions, chopped
1/2 cup beef broth
2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
1-1/2 teaspoons sugar
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
Dash dried rosemary, crushed
Dash dried thyme
PIMIENTO CHEESE:
2-1/2 cups shredded smoked Gouda cheese
2-1/2 cups shredded sharp cheddar cheese
1/2 cup mayonnaise
2 jars (4 ounces each) diced pimientos, drained
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on hot pepper sauce
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on pepper
9 bacon strips, cooked and crumbled

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°. Place bread on baking sheets. Bake 4-6 minutes or until light brown., In a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add onions; cook and stir 4-6 minutes or until softened. Stir in broth, vinegar, sugar and seasonings.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ook 12-15 minutes or until liquid is evaporated, stirring occasionally., In a large bowl, toss cheeses; beat in mayonnaise, pimientos, Worcestershire sauce, pepper sauce and seasonings. Spread 1 tablespoon mixture over each baguette slice; top with 2 teaspoons onion mixture. Sprinkle with bacon. Bake 3-4 minutes or until cheese is melted.

SMOKY PIMIENTO CHEESE WITH BACON



Smoky Pimiento Cheese With Bacon image

Great pimiento cheese is all about spice. Red peppers and hot sauce are essential to cutting through the richness of the cream cheese and cheddar.

Provided by Todd Richards

Yield Makes about 3 cups

Number Of Ingredients 14

4 bacon slices
1 tablespoon blended olive oil
2 small red bell peppers, stems removed, finely diced (about 1¼ cups)
2 teaspoons adobo sauce from canned chipotle peppers
1⁄4 cup mayonnaise
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
2 teaspoons hot sauce
1⁄2 teaspoon dry mustard
1⁄2 teaspoon granulated garlic
1⁄4 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per
4 ounces white cheddar cheese, shredded (about 1 cup)
4 ounces sharp cheddar cheese, shredded (about 1 cup)
4 ounces cream cheese, softened
2 tablespoons thinly sliced chives

Steps:

  • Cook bacon in a heavy-bottomed skillet over medium-high 5 to 6 minutes or until crisp. Remove bacon from skillet and drain on paper towels; chop. Reserve 1 tablespoon bacon drippings, and set aside. Wipe the skillet clean.
  • Return the skillet to medium. Add the blended oil and the red bell peppers. Cook until tender, about 2 minutes. Stir in the bacon drippings. Add the adobo sauce, and cook 2 minutes. Remove from the heat. Stir in the bacon, mayonnaise, vinegar, hot sauce, dry mustard, granulated garlic, and black pepper.
  • Combine the cheddar cheeses, cream cheese, and bell pepper mixture in a large bowl. Stir in the chives, and serve at room temperature.
